The Impact Of Packaging Design Box On Consumer Perception

When it comes to marketing a product, packaging plays a crucial role in attracting and engaging consumers. The packaging design box is often the first thing a customer sees when encountering a product, making it a vital component in shaping their perception. In this article, we will explore the importance of packaging design box and its impact on consumer behavior.

packaging design box refers to the creation of an aesthetically pleasing and functional box that houses a product. This includes the use of colors, typography, images, and materials to create a visually appealing and memorable package. A well-designed box can effectively communicate the brand identity, product features, and value proposition to consumers.

One of the key reasons why packaging design box is so important is its ability to capture the attention of consumers. In a world where consumers are bombarded with countless products vying for their attention, having a well-designed box can make a product stand out on the shelf. A visually appealing package can draw customers in and pique their curiosity, prompting them to pick up the product and learn more about it.

Furthermore, packaging design box plays a crucial role in conveying the brand’s image and identity. The design elements used in the packaging, such as colors, fonts, and imagery, should be aligned with the brand’s values and positioning. This helps to create a strong brand identity and ensures consistency across all touchpoints. When consumers see a well-designed box that reflects the brand’s personality, they are more likely to form a positive impression of the product and brand.

In addition to attracting consumers and conveying brand identity, packaging design box also influences consumer perceptions of product quality. Research has shown that consumers often associate the quality of a product with the quality of its packaging. A well-designed and sturdy box can create the impression that the product inside is high-quality and worth the price. On the other hand, a poorly designed or flimsy box can give the impression of a low-quality product, even if the actual product is of good quality.

Beyond aesthetics and quality perception, packaging design box also plays a practical role in protecting the product and enhancing the overall user experience. A well-designed box should not only look good but also be functional and easy to use. The box should be durable enough to protect the product during shipping and handling, and should also be easy to open and close. A frustrating or inconvenient packaging experience can negatively impact the consumer’s perception of the product and brand.

Moreover, packaging design box can also be used to communicate important information about the product, such as usage instructions, ingredients, and benefits. This information is essential for consumers to make informed purchasing decisions and can help build trust and credibility with the brand. Including clear and concise information on the box can enhance the overall user experience and create a sense of transparency and honesty.

Another important aspect of packaging design box is its environmental impact. In today’s eco-conscious world, consumers are increasingly looking for sustainable and environmentally friendly packaging options. Brands that use recyclable materials, minimize waste, and reduce carbon footprint in their packaging design box can appeal to environmentally conscious consumers and differentiate themselves from competitors.
